RANCHI, India, Oct. 9 -- Jharkhand High Court issued the following order on Sept. 9:
1. Heard learned counsel appearing on behalf of Petitioners and learned APP appearing on behalf of the State.
2. The petitioners are apprehending their arrest in connection with Pathargama P.S. Case No.108 of 2025, for the alleged offences registered under Sections 126(2), 115(2) 118(1), 191(2), 190, 303(2), 352, 109, 76 and 3(5) of Bhartiya Nyaya Sanhita, 2023, pending in the Court of learned SDJM, Godda.
3. Learned counsel appearing for the petitioners submits that there is case and counter case between the parties and the petitioners and informant side are the family members. He further submits that the first case has been lodged by the petitioner No.1 and thereafter this case has been lodged and there are general and omnibus allegations against all the accused persons and the said dispute has arisen out of land.
4. Learned counsel for the State opposed the prayer and submits that the injuries have been received.
5. In view of the above and considering that the petitioners are ladies and there are general and omnibus allegations against the petitioners and the petitioner No.1 has lodged the first case against the informant side, thereafter the present case has been lodged, I am inclined to grant anticipatory bail to the petitioners.
6. Accordingly, the petitioners above named are directed to surrender before the learned Court within three weeks from the date of receipt of the order and on the event of their surrender / arrest, they shall be released on bail on furnishing bail bond of Rs.25,000/- (Twenty-Five Thousand) each with two sureties of the like amount of each to the satisfaction of learned SDJM, Godda, in connection with Pathargama P.S. Case No.108 of 2025subject to the condition as laid down under Section 482(2) of Bhartiya Nagarik Suraksha Sanhita, 2023.
7. This Anticipatory Bail Application is accordingly allowed and disposed of.
